Blue Cross Travel Launches Biggest-Ever Awareness Campaign in Ontario
by Bruce Parkinson
Blue Cross Travel has unveiled its largest-ever awareness campaign in Ontario, introducing a new brand platform dubbed “We’re on it.”
The insurer says it is reinforcing its commitment to helping travellers and the travel professionals who serve them to better understand the value of expert travel assistance.
Designed to reach millions of Ontarians through a province-wide media investment, the initiative aims to strengthen awareness of travel protection while creating more opportunities for brokers, travel advisors and industry partners to engage travellers before they depart.
Rather than focusing on insurance alone, the campaign reframes the conversation around what travellers value most: knowing that when the unexpected happens, an experienced team takes charge.
Travellers don’t just worry about getting sick or having their trip disrupted – their concerns extend to navigating hospitals, language barriers, unexpected costs, changing flights and difficult decisions far from home. Blue Cross Travel says its assistance team manages those complexities around the clock, allowing travellers to focus on what matters most.
“This campaign is more than building our brand; it’s about building confidence in travel assistance,” said Mathieu Nezan, Senior Director, Integrated Marketing. “When travellers understand the value of expert assistance before they leave, every conversation becomes more meaningful.”

Blue Cross Travel says travel assistance is much more than answering the phone — it’s coordinating complex care when every minute matters.
“For more than 80 years, Blue Cross has been one of the few travel insurers to provide fully integrated, end-to-end assistance entirely in-house. Our multidisciplinary team of assistance specialists, nurses, physicians and medical experts works seamlessly with a trusted global network of accredited hospitals, healthcare providers and air ambulance partners. From the first call to a traveller’s safe return home, every step is coordinated with expertise, compassion, and 24/7 support,” the company states.
The creative platform of the Blue Cross Travel campaign is based on a simple insight: travellers don’t just fear what could happen abroad–they fear having to handle it alone.
Campaign messages such as “If something breaks on spring break” and “If things go south while down south” reinforce the insurer’s new brand promise: “We’re on it.”
